ABSTRACT:
A hair transplant mechanism in which a cartridge holding numerous hair micrografts feeds a plunger mechanism. The plunger mechanism presses individual hair micrografts through a barrel to be deposited into an incision formed by a scalpel. The mechanism, using this arrangement, allows the surgeon to create an incision along a designated line and to implant the hair micrografts in a one step operation.
